U2 - All These Things That I've Done

The Killers - Stay

Bono once joined The Killers on stage for "All These Things That I've Done" a few years back and his voice fit the song really well. Brandon Flowers even said the song was inspired by U2, specifically "All That You Can't Leave Behind". I'd love to hear U2 cover it sometime.

And in return, I think Stay would be a song that's very suitable for Flowers' voice and The Killers style of music.
